Roof Cleaning - Truths
About Roof CleaningTable of ContentsRoof Cleaning - TruthsNot known Details About Roof Cleaning Unknown Facts About Roof CleaningThe Roof Cleaning IdeasFacts About Roof Cleaning RevealedThe Facts About Roof Cleaning RevealedThings about Roof CleaningIt's not something a lot of us consider really often, yet practically every kind of roof readily ava